Struct linfa_bayes::MultinomialNbValidParams
source · pub struct MultinomialNbValidParams<F, L> { /* private fields */ }
Expand description
A verified hyper-parameter set ready for the estimation of a Multinomial Naive Bayes model.
See MultinomialNb
for information on the model and MultinomialNbParams
for information on hyperparameters.
